News: Breaking changes for all users of `varnish`, which is renamed to `vinyl-cache` (opens in new tab)

All references to "varnish" have been changed to "vinyl" in all binaries and directories. At minimum, users will have to: rename /etc/varnish to /etc/vinyl-cache rename /var/lib/varnish to /var/lib/vinyl-cache fix up ownership of files inside /var/lib/varnish user varnish becomes vinyl group...
